Genesis 44:24-34 New American Bible, Revised Edition (NABRE)

24. When we returned to your servant my father, we reported to him the words of my lord.

25. “Later, our father said, ‘Go back and buy some food for us.’

26. So we reminded him, ‘We cannot go down there; only if our youngest brother is with us can we go, for we may not see the man if our youngest brother is not with us.’

27. Then your servant my father said to us, ‘As you know, my wife bore me two sons.

28. One of them, however, has gone away from me, and I said, “He must have been torn to pieces by wild beasts!” I have not seen him since.

29. If you take this one away from me too, and a disaster befalls him, you will send my white head down to Sheol in grief.’

30. “So now, if the boy is not with us when I go back to your servant my father, whose very life is bound up with his, he will die as soon as he sees that the boy is missing;

31. and your servants will thus send the white head of your servant our father down to Sheol in grief.

32. Besides, I, your servant, have guaranteed the boy’s safety for my father by saying, ‘If I fail to bring him back to you, father, I will bear the blame before you forever.’

33. So now let me, your servant, remain in place of the boy as the slave of my lord, and let the boy go back with his brothers.

34. How could I go back to my father if the boy were not with me? I could not bear to see the anguish that would overcome my father.”
